Any tool that will you scrape the seeds from your clothing is sufficient to help you remove beggar-lice, but the tool that will work the best is either a butter knife or a small pocket comb. Simply pull the fabric taught, and use the knife or comb to get in between the burr and the fabric. Buy a glove specifically designed to remove burrs from clothing if you're often … can i add water to the coolant in a carWebAs someone that regularly deals with burrs and other modes of plant seed distribution, my best advice is to wear clothing that burrs don't stick to as well. Nylon hiking shells seem to work best. Fleece, the least. Other than prevention, the metal ruler trick works very well to bend the trichomes of the burr and pop it off. can i add water to radiatorWeb25 sep. 2024 · Learned a way to remove burrs from clothing that is way easier and more effective than picking them off one by one.
